The informized life - chances and visions of interdisciplinary research for life`s challenges in a world filled with computer science and information technology.
The 4th annual convention of the Center for Informatics and Information Technology, tubs.CITY, will take place on June 7 - 8, 2012. This year`s convention centers on the topic "The informized life", which we want to explore together with partners from science and industry.
Already today, our modern world surrounds us with manifold systems arising from computer science and communication technology. This will only intensify in the future, and our environment will be more and more permeated by such systems. New connections, structures and mechanisms will develop, which will reach beyond pure information, but will fundamentally permeate and change our world and our lives: they will be "informized". The "informized person" is a central part in such a world.
tubs.CITY stands for visions for an informized life - a life within information society, which is accompanied by modern information systems in every domain, and is thereby formed by information and technology. Various research groups of tubs.CITY, related to computer science and information technology work together an these visions - for tomorrow`s mobility, accomodation, and quality of life. The goal is to master social challenges, for example demographic change, the increasing digitalization of all areas of life, as well as the demand for sustainable growth.
Visions and technology research combine to applications that are innovative and technologically advanced, while incorporating the needs and demands of individuals, organizations, and society.
On the first day, Thursday, June 7, we offer between 9 am and 5 pm a wide range of presentations by selected external guests. The goal is to exhibit a wide spectrum of current scientific research and visions, that form the basis of our informized world. Furthermore we wish to discuss future challenges and possibilities for merging their varied aspects.
